The Oregon Legislature authorized an LCFS program in 2009 as part of House Bill 2186, tasking the Department of Environmental Quality (DEQ) to design the program. The proposal is modeled after California LCFS while being customized to meet conditions in Oregon. Washington. Earlier post.)

The first vehicle powered by an ethanol-based fuel cell was developed in 2007, Feng said. Researchers in the US and China have developed a catalyst that solves three key problems long associated with direct ethanol fuel cells (DEFCs): low efficiency, the cost of catalytic materials and the toxicity of chemical reactions inside the cells.
